Arlington's workforce is heavily tied to the Pentagon, federal agencies, and government contractors, and many residents work long or irregular hours, so calls to home service providers often land in the evening when small local offices have already closed for the day. The county's dense high-rise corridor around Rosslyn and Ballston creates urgent, time-sensitive maintenance calls from property managers and condo residents who expect a same-day response, and a missed call there usually gets forwarded straight to the building's backup vendor list.
